What is BugHerd?
BugHerd is a visual feedback and task management tool that helps teams collaborate on website projects.
What browsers are supported by BugHerd?
BugHerd supports the latest versions of Chrome, Firefox, Safari, and Edge.
Does BugHerd integrate with other tools?
Yes, BugHerd integrates with popular project management tools like Jira, Trello, Asana, and more.
Does BugHerd have a mobile app?
Yes, BugHerd has a mobile app for iOS and Android devices.
Does BugHerd offer a free trial?
Yes, BugHerd offers a 14-day free trial for all plans.
Does BugHerd offer customer support?
Yes, BugHerd offers customer support via email and live chat.

Python: A Comprehensive Overview

Python is a powerful, high-level, object-oriented programming language.

It is an interpreted language, meaning that it is not compiled into machine code before it is run.

Python is easy to learn and use, making it a great choice for beginners and experienced developers alike.

It is open source, meaning that it is free to use and modify.

Who Should Use Python?

Python is a great choice for anyone looking to develop software, from beginners to experienced developers.

It is also a great choice for data scientists, web developers, and system administrators.

Python is used in a variety of industries, including finance, healthcare, and education.

What is Python?
Python is an interpreted, high-level, general-purpose programming language.
What is the latest version of Python?
The latest version of Python is Python 3.9.1, released on October 5, 2020.
What platforms does Python run on?
Python runs on Windows, Linux/Unix, Mac OS X, OS/2, Amiga, Palm Handhelds, and Nokia mobile phones.
What is the license for Python?
Python is released under the Python Software Foundation License, which is a free open source license.
What is the official website for Python?
The official website for Python is https://www.python.org/
What is the Python Enhancement Proposal (PEP) process?
The Python Enhancement Proposal (PEP) process is the process by which new features are proposed and accepted into the Python language.
Where can I find Python documentation?
Python documentation can be found on the official Python website at https://docs.python.org/
